Skull Comics #3, November 1971, 36 pages There were 6 numbers of Skull Comics printed between 1970 and 1972 and there are several of them available online—except for #3. This copy is from the first printing (of 10,000), as evidenced by the registration mark in a scarlet pentagon on the b…ack cover. The cover features a rare horror illustration from Spain Rodriguez. Contact seller5-star seller5th Printing. [36]pp., including semi-glossy color covers, and b/w interior. Stories and Art by Richard Corben, CHarls Dallas, Larry Todd, and Spain Rodriguez. Cover by Spain Rodriguez. This issue presents comic adaptations of the H.P. Lovecraft classics "The Rats in the Walls" by the Inimitable Richard Corben, "To a Dreamer" il…lustrated by Charles Dallas, "The Shadow From the Abyss" by Larry Todd, and an original story by Spain Rodriguez. The text pages are clean, but there is light, generalized toning. "Though horror and violence had already surfaced in some undergrounds (e. G. , Bogeyman) , nothing compared to Skull Comix #1, which featured the decapitation of a naked woman and zombies on peyote, and those were mere harbingers of what was to come. Skull explored all manner of the horror genre, from interpreting the classic writings of Edgar Allan Poe to modern elucidations and hallucinations. Skull didn't venture quite so extensively as its spiritual compatriot Slow Death, so it might not be considered as broadly entertaining, but it mined the traditional horror genre unlike any other anthology in the underground. The macabre tales of H. P. Lovecraft were prominently featured in the fourth and fifth issues of the series. The series finale in issue #6 featured a gruesome, marvelous full-length epic of horror by Tom Veitch, illustrated in two parts by Greg Irons and Richard Corben." (from Underground Comix Collection).
